Under the circumstances of a war that has lasted for more than three years in the Gaza Strip, the Zaarab family held an exceptional celebration to honor about 700 high school graduates from the family in the governorates of Khan Younis and Rafah. This celebration was delayed due to the difficult conditions the sector has experienced, including shelling, displacement, and the loss of loved ones. The family lost more than 200 martyrs, and their homes were affected. Despite these hardships, the students managed to overcome the challenges, with around 140 students enrolling in universities, more than 90% of whom are studying university majors. This reflects the students' resilience, attachment to education, and hope. The celebrants affirm that success is a form of resistance and hope in the face of the war's aftermath. The celebration of the students serves as a message to future generations about the importance of education in confronting challenges and continuing to build despite the pain.
